Analyse syntaxique en Perl 6

Analyse syntaxique en Perl 6

Par Stéphane Payrard (‎cognominal‎) de Paris.pm
Date : samedi 13 juin 2009 14h00
Durée : 40 minutes
Cible : Tous
Langue : Français
Tags : parrot perl6 pge regex syntaxe


Perl6 offre un moteur d'analyse qui inclut plusieurs stratégies.
Contrairement à Perl5, Il est complètement intégré au langage.
Les grammaires sont des classes et les tokens/regexen/règles
sont des méthodes.

La grammaire est plus régulière qu'en Perl 5 et le contrôle
de retour sur trace beaucoup plus fin.

Perl6 a une grammaire complexe. Donc pour bootstrapper un compilateur, il faut un analyseur syntaxique sophistiqué, donc cet analyseur est la partie la plus mûre de Perl 6.


Présentation suivie par: Guillaume Sadegh, marc chantreux (‎eiro‎), Stéphane Payrard (‎cognominal‎), Florian Hatat, Patrick Mevzek, Emmanuel Di Pretoro (‎saorge‎), Ralf Wurzinger, Thierry DESSOLES (‎tdessoles‎), Nils Grunwald, Franck Cuny, Alexandre Jousset (‎Mid'‎), Jérôme Fenal, Grégoire Baron (‎baronchon‎), Sébastien Aperghis-Tramoni (‎Maddingue‎),